The secret to mastering mixed textures lies in cultivating cohesion, not clutter
When you combine different materials like wool, silk, denim, leather, or even knit and metallic finishes
you want each element to complement the others without competing for attention
Begin with a tonally quiet foundation
Neutral tones like stone, oat, slate, or charcoal provide the perfect canvas for tactile variety

Try a cable-knit cardigan with patent leather trousers, or a crushed velvet jacket layered over a satin camisole
Let texture add dimension, not distraction, through unified tones
Avoid overloading your outfit with too many bold textures at once
If you’re wearing a textured coat, keep the rest of your look simpler
Let one piece be the star and let the others support it subtly
Understand the reflective properties of each material
Shiny surfaces like satin or metallics reflect more light and can draw the eye
Dull finishes such as linen, corduroy, or wool blend into the background
Counteract shine with matte layers to create visual rhythm
Consider the overall shape and volume of your outfit
An oversized knit risks looking shapeless when matched with a puffer or wide-leg pant
Counterweight bulk with slim-cut denim, tailored trousers, or a pencil skirt
The goal is to create visual interest without confusion
Harmonized textures convey thoughtfulness, depth, and refined taste
